Press src hold menu button down,press seek button up to change option to "auh" press seek button left or right till it says on. problem solved i had to figure it out myself good luck

  • Selecting the (SRC) button to "AUH" which is the auxiliary input.
  • If this does not work.
  • Then set the unit to standby mode. By pressing the (SRC) button until "STBY" is displayed. You need to check that "On AUH" is enabled. Now try the "AUH" again.

I hooked up an aux cable to my KDC-MO4028 but the aux input option is not coming up as an option for one of the sources.

Hi David,

A decent info page for this radio and options is at Crutchfiled. They seems to provide good / very good information on all the products they sell. Service and pricing is up to you. To use Aux inputs, you need to purchase and connect the optional Aux Input Adapter (picture below).


10_2_2011_12_12_05_pm.gif

Crutchfield sells these for about $20, and they plug into the jack on the rear of the radio. The jacks on the cables attached to the radio are preamp outputs - not inputs; and will not work as an input.

Cant seem to get the aux up on my kenwood kdc-237 tried from src button but to no avail can anybody advise please

Its becuase the aux is turned off as default so you have to activate it.
Put the unit into standby mode
Press menu for at least a second untill menu appears and then select the aux option and edit it to either aux on1 or aux on2 or aux off.

AUX input won't work

The red and white RCA terminals on the back of the unit are generally outputs for amplifiers. To use AUX the unit will need to have a 3.5mm jack in the front or rear. If not than the unit does not have AUX input capabilities.

I have a Kenwood KDC MP2035, it is brand new, I try listening to somehting plugged into the AUX but when i press SRC to select AUX, AUX does not show up, only TUNER and STANDBY are in the options so far

here is some thing that will help u out. AUX Input: The KDC-MP2035 is equipped with a front panel 3.5mm minijack auxiliary input for connecting external portable audio devices such as an MP3 player or Tape walkman. The receiver allows you to select between the following AUX settings.
  • Off: the source button does not scroll through the AUX input when function is turned "off"
  • Aux 1: turns on the AUX input for use
